Summary

Katy Kaminski joins Niels Kaastrup-Larsen to assess early 2026 markets through a systematic trend-following lens. They discuss strong commodity and metals trends, US dollar weakness, and the broadening of trend opportunities across sectors. Katy explains her research on CTA dispersion, speed, market concentration, and volatility estimation, arguing that diversification across markets and models is increasingly important. They also discuss crisis alpha, geopolitical risk, and the outlook for trend following.

  • Precious and base metals are showing strong early-2026 trends.
  • US dollar weakness and Aussie dollar strength are supporting momentum.
  • Trend following has started 2026 strongly after a difficult 2025.
  • CTA performance dispersion is driven by speed, universe, and volatility sizing.
  • Fully diversified CTAs may capture commodity trends better than narrow replicators.
  • Volatility estimation is a hidden but important driver of CTA returns.
  • Crisis alpha and geopolitical risk are framed as favorable for trend following.
  • Katy previews upcoming research on geopolitical risk and managed futures.

Central banks and Tether support gold.
Gold is supported by a major monetary shift: central banks have been net buyers every year since 2011 after selling in 2000-2009, and Tether has become a large holder. These structural flows help explain the extreme move and could support sustained gold demand.
Niels Kaastrup-Larsen Founder & Host, Top Traders Unplugged 5:04
Dollar tests 200-month average; watch breakdown.
The US dollar is testing its 200-month simple moving average and attempting to break down. If it does, a structurally weak dollar world would have broad implications and would likely support commodities, although this is a developing setup rather than a confirmed trend.
Niels Kaastrup-Larsen Founder & Host, Top Traders Unplugged 6:10
Monetary regime shift favors commodity super cycle.
A commodity super cycle usually takes off when there is a change in the monetary system. With the US dollar testing a long-term breakdown and central banks buying gold, this time may be different from prior false starts, supporting very sustained trends in commodities.
Niels Kaastrup-Larsen Founder & Host, Top Traders Unplugged 6:57
Diversified CTAs beat narrow replicators.
Replicators tend to trade fewer markets and have much less commodity exposure than fully diversified CTAs. If a commodity super cycle unfolds, their narrower universe could remove the diversification and return benefits that fully diversified CTAs offer.

Broad metals trends need diversified exposure.
Trend profitability has broadened across a wide range of metals, including copper, aluminum, silver, gold, platinum, and palladium. Gold does not fully represent all of these trends, so diversified metals exposure captures multiple themes and reduces dependence on one asset.
Niels Kaastrup-Larsen Founder & Host, Top Traders Unplugged 14:14
Negative press signals trend following buy.
Negative press coverage of trend following and managed futures is usually not a bad sign and often marks a buying opportunity, because the strategy is cyclical and tends to recover after challenging periods.
Niels Kaastrup-Larsen Founder & Host, Top Traders Unplugged 14:33
Cocoa shows commodity trend opportunity.
Cocoa is among the idiosyncratic commodities showing opportunities, adding to the broad set of commodity trends beyond metals.
Katy Kaminski Chief Research Strategist, AlphaSimplex Group 15:51
Equities remain positive trend contributor.
Equities have continued to be a positive trending contributor, adding to multi-sector trend profitability and helping diversify a portfolio that also has weak-dollar and commodity trends.
Katy Kaminski Chief Research Strategist, AlphaSimplex Group 15:57
Short dollar, long Aussie momentum.
The short US dollar theme has extended and worked very well, with the Australian dollar particularly strong. The combination of a weak dollar, pro-growth trends, and pro-metals trends creates multiple diversified momentum themes rather than a single narrow trade.

Boom-bust environment favors trend following.
Trend following is off to a roaring start, and the current extreme, boom-bust environment is very positive for the strategy. Trend following can participate in the boom and then pivot to participate positively in the bust, unlike steady markets or isolated shocks.
